The Asia Pacific Alternative Legal Services Providers (ALSP) Market is expected to witness market growth of 9.4% CAGR during the forecast period (2025-2032).

The India market dominated the Asia Pacific Alternative Legal Services Providers (ALSP) Market by country in 2024, and is expected to continue to be a dominant market till 2032; thereby, achieving a market value of $2.49 billion by 2032. The China market is showcasing a CAGR of 6.5% during 2025-2032. Additionally, the Japan market would register a CAGR of 8.5% during 2025-2032.



Alternative Legal Services Providers (ALSPs) are quickly finding that the Asia Pacific region is an important field for growth. This is due to globalization, changing regulatory frameworks, and more advanced in-house legal teams. India, Singapore, Australia, Hong Kong, Japan, South Korea, and China are all seeing a growing need for legal help that is both cheap and centered on technology. ALSPs are helping businesses in the area with a wide range of tasks, including contract management, due diligence, eDiscovery, IP support, and following the rules.

Legal Innovation and Offshoring in Asia Pacific

  • India and the Philippines are legal centers: India and the Philippines are becoming popular places to outsource legal work because they have a lot of English-speaking workers and their costs are lower.
  • The growth of legal operations in Singapore and Australia: ALSPs are working closely with legal innovation teams in places like Singapore and Australia that want to make workflows smarter and more automated.
  • Separating Legal Services: Clients don't want legal help that fits everyone anymore. They want ALSPs that break services down and only offer what they need, quickly.

Regulatory Needs and Needs Across Borders

  • Data privacy rules make compliance work easier: Companies need ALSPs to help them meet compliance needs in the region because of new data laws like China's PIPL and India's DPDP.
  • More and more legal's tasks are being done in more than one language: Companies are asking ALSPs for help with reviewing legal documents in different languages and making contracts the same in all countries.
  • Help for sectors that are growing quickly: Sectors like fintech, life sciences, and manufacturing depend on ALSPs for legal help and regulatory research that can grow quickly.

Country Outlook

The market for Alternative Legal Services Providers (ALSPs) in China has grown a lot in the last few years. This is mostly because the country is going through a digital transformation and businesses need cheap, tech-based legal services more than ever. As traditional law firms are being pushed to cut costs and work more efficiently, the need for ALSPs in China is growing. ALSPs are making themselves out to be important partners for businesses, especially multinational and tech companies, that are having trouble dealing with complicated domestic rules and compliance needs.

Japan: Gradual Shift in Legal Services

  • Japan has relied on traditional legal services for a long time, but that is starting to change because of changes in business needs and society.
  • More Japanese businesses are willing to use ALSPs because they need legal help that is cheap and flexible, especially as legal work builds up and budgets get tighter because of the economy.
  • Digital and Corporate Reform Push: Japan's larger digital transformation and changes in corporate governance are pushing businesses to update their legal processes with the help of ALSPs.
Japan’s ALSP market is slowly evolving as businesses seek cost-effective legal support, driven by economic pressures, digital transformation, and corporate reforms reshaping traditional legal practices.

India: A Legal Outsourcing and Innovation Powerhouse

  • A Long History of Legal Outsourcing India has a long history of outsourcing and a large pool of skilled, English-speaking professionals, which is why it is trusted for legal help.
  • Going beyond just support Indian ALSPs aren't just following; they're in charge. They're coming up with smarter, tech-based ways to get legal work done faster.
  • A lot of different services Indian ALSPs can quickly and reliably handle a lot of legal work, both simple and complicated. They do everything from checking contracts to making sure that rules and IP are followed.
India is now the world's top ALSP, providing affordable, technology-based legal services. It has strong roots in outsourcing and now leads the way in new legal processes for research, compliance, contracts, and intellectual property.
